Soup Sampler #1 Ingredient prep:
(Makes 2 pints each: Chipotle Beef Soup, Chipotle Chicken Soup, Beef Stew, Chicken Corn Chowder)
2 2/3 cups trimmed beef, cubed (about 1.25 lbs trimmed)
2 2/3 cups rotisserie chicken, cut in large chunks (about 1 medium rotisserie chicken)
2 cups chopped bell peppers (red, orange)
6T seeded and diced jalapenos
2 cups diced onion
1/3 cup, sliced carrots
2 cups diced potatoes, peeled and water soaked
2-8 tsp chopped chipotles in adobo sauce
¾ cup corn kernels
12T peeled, diced tomatoes (3/4 cup)
2 to 2 1/4 cups beef broth
2 ½ to 2 3/4 cups chicken broth
3 tsp salt
2 tsp steak seasoning
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p smoked paprika
1 tsp cumin
1.5 tsp black pepper
½ tsp dried thyme
Divide ingredients among 8 pint jars as directed in recipes below. Process in pressure canner for 75 minutes at the appropriate lbs/pressure for your altitude. Do not use the processing time for “soups”.
If preparing quarts instead of pints, double each recipe per quart. Process in pressure canner for 90 minutes at the appropriate lbs/pressure for your altitude. Do not use the processing time for “soups”.

Chipotle Beef Soup (per pint)
2/3 cup (about 5 oz) trimmed beef, cubed
1/2 cup chopped bell peppers (red, orange)
1T seeded and diced jalapenos
¼ cup diced onion
0.5-2 tsp chopped chipotles in adobo sauce
1T corn kernels
2T peeled, diced tomatoes
1/2 cup beef broth (to headspace)
1/2 tsp salt
1/4 tsp garlic powder
1/4 tsp smoked paprika
1/4 tsp cumin
1/4 tsp black pepper
Chipotle Chicken Soup (per pint)
2/3 cup rotisserie chicken, white and dark, large chunks
1/2 cup chopped bell peppers (red, orange)
1T seeded and diced jalapenos
¼ cup diced onion
0.5-2 tsp chopped chipotles in adobo sauce
1T corn kernels
2T peeled, diced tomatoes
1/2 cup chicken broth, plus more if needed to reach proper headspace.
1/2 tsp salt
1/4 tsp garlic powder
1/4 tsp smoked paprika
1/4 tsp cumin
1/4 tsp black pepper
Chicken Corn Chowder (per pint)
2/3 cup rotisserie chicken, white and dark, large chunks
1T seeded and diced jalapenos
¼ cup diced onion
¼ cup corn kernels
1/2 cup diced potatoes, peeled and water soaked
½ tsp salt
¼ tsp pepper
½ to 2/3 cup chicken broth
Beef Stew (per pint)
2/3 cup (about 5 oz) trimmed beef, cubed
1/6 cup diced carrots
¼ cup diced onion
1/2 cup diced potatoes, peeled and water soaked
1 tsp steak seasoning
2T peeled, diced tomatoes
¼ tsp dried Thyme
1/3 to 1/2 cup beef broth
